The connected logistics market refers to the integration of digital technologies, IoT devices, cloud computing, and advanced analytics into logistics operations to enhance visibility, efficiency, and automation across the supply chain. Connected logistics systems enable real-time tracking of goods, fleet management, inventory optimization, route planning, and predictive maintenance.

Technologies used include IoT sensors, RFID, GPS tracking, AI-powered analytics, cloud platforms, digital twins, blockchain, and 5G connectivity.
The rapid growth of e-commerce, globalization, and the need for end-to-end supply chain transparency are driving adoption.


2. Market Dynamics

Drivers

  • Growing demand for real-time supply chain visibility.

  • Rapid expansion of e-commerce and last-mile delivery services.

  • Increasing adoption of IoT, AI, and cloud solutions in logistics operations.

  • Rising need for predictive analytics to reduce downtime and improve asset utilization.

  • Government initiatives supporting smart logistics and digital infrastructure.

Restraints

  • High initial investment in connected infrastructure and devices.

  • Concerns about cybersecurity and data privacy.

  • Integration challenges with existing legacy logistics systems.

  • Limited digital readiness in developing regions.

Opportunities

  • Growing investments in autonomous vehicles, drones, and robotics for logistics.

  • Expansion of 5G networks, enabling low-latency logistics operations.

  • Increasing adoption of blockchain for secure and transparent supply chain transactions.

  • Demand for smart warehouses equipped with IoT-enabled automation and monitoring.

  • Emerging opportunities in cold chain logistics, pharma supply chains, and food safety monitoring.

Challenges

  • Interoperability issues between diverse IoT platforms and devices.

  • Lack of skilled workforce for advanced logistics technologies.

  • Growing threat of cyberattacks on supply chain networks.
